Output 2d984ddf4ff4698d6aac5a3ed61aaba630a5df07a5ad6d33ccecf58b948399a4:1

value
38521059621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a5e28c7c8c8015508837c289470560578a7526 OP_EQUAL
address
34kvwmCtyP1fYRug63rYmLLp3KgraTL156
transaction
2d984ddf4ff4698d6aac5a3ed61aaba630a5df07a5ad6d33ccecf58b948399a4
spent
true